This unique text atlas on brachial plexus surgery and pathology
describes 60 different lesions in very detailed and instructive
color drawings by one of the foremost pioneers and experts in this
field. After his death in 1993, Narakas is still greatly admired
and many specialists are eagerly awaiting this book. Anatomical
variations of the lesions, the problem and the surgical treatment
are presented. Clinical data and follow-up of the patients are
included with each lesion. Traumatic lesions, tumors and obstetric
and irradiation lesions are presented.
